A capacitor that is initially uncharged is connected in series with a resistor and a 300.0 V emf source with negligible internal resistance. Just after the circuit is completed, the current through the resistor is 0.950 mA and the time constant for the circuit is 6.00 s. (A) What is the resistance of the resistor? Express your answer with the appropriate units. (B) What is the capacitance of the capacitor? Express your answer with the appropriate units.
